Anduril Industries is a defense technology company with a mission to transform U.S. and allied military capabilities with advanced technology. By bringing the expertise, technology, and business model of the 21st century's most innovative companies to the defense industry, Anduril is changing how military systems are designed, built and sold. Anduril's family of systems is powered by Lattice OS, an AI-powered operating system that turns thousands of data streams into a realtime, 3D command and control center.

As the world enters an era of strategic competition, Anduril is committed to bringing cutting-edge autonomy, AI, computer vision, sensor fusion, and networking technology to the military in months, not years. The Test and Evaluation team at Anduril plays a crucial role in our mission, ensuring that every product meets the highest standards of performance and reliability. Our team conducts full system level development testing, new production acceptance testing, software validation testing and much more.

This position is looking for a highly motivated test and evaluation engineering manager for the Altius UAS platform. You will perform evaluation of hardware and software capabilities in lab and flight test environment and lead a team of test engineers. ABOUT THE JOB
The Test and Evaluation team is seeking a Test and Evaluation Engineering Manager. In this role you will lead a team of test engineers to conduct system level development testing and evaluate hardware and software readiness. WHAT YOU'LL DO
* Lead and mentor a team of test engineers, fostering their technical growth and ensuring adherence to best practices.
* Oversee the planning and execution of complex test efforts, including task delegation and resource coordination for team members.
* Collaborate closely with software engineers and cross functional teams to ensure thorough validation of new software, end-to-end functionality, and bug fixes.
* Conduct Software and Surrogate platform testing, including validation and regression tests to ensure new features align with system capabilities and mission objectives.
* Analyze data from tests to validate system performance and identify areas for improvement, iterating rapidly to refine hardware implementation and software behaviors.
* Create processes for testing system functionality using HITL and COTS UAS platforms
* Drive the advancement of Anduril's testing methodologies, with a focus on Group 2 UAS, to ensure robust and reliable performance in complex operational scenarios.
* Contribute to the strategic direction of the T&E team, identifying opportunities for process improvements and advocating for advanced testing tools and methodologies. RE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S
* A bachelor's degree in engineering, computer science, robotics, or a related technical field from an accredited institution, or equivalent experience in robotics or autonomous systems testing.
* Minimum of 6 years of experience in software/hardware testing, with a strong emphasis on autonomous or remotely piloted systems.
* Minimum 2 years in a lead or mentoring role for technical teams, or significant project leadership.
* Demonstrated ability in developing and executing test plans for complex systems within aggressive timelines.
* Willingness to work flexible hours and travel to various testing locations up to 25% of the time
* Must be able to obtain and maintain a U.S. Secret-Level security clearance. P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
* Experience in the development, flight testing, and deployment of unmanned systems in a defense or aerospace context.
* Familiarity with software development practices and experience with programming languages used in autonomy and robotics (e.g., Python, C++, Rust).
* Hands-on experience with hardware integration in HITL and flight test environments.
